Partage via


XPathNavigator.ValueAsDouble Propriété

Définition

Obtient la valeur du nœud actuel en tant que Double.

public:
 virtual property double ValueAsDouble { double get(); };
public override double ValueAsDouble { get; }
member this.ValueAsDouble : double
Public Overrides ReadOnly Property ValueAsDouble As Double

Valeur de propriété

Double

Valeur du nœud actuel en tant que Double.

Exceptions

La valeur de chaîne du nœud actuel ne peut pas être convertie en Double.

La tentative de cast en Double n'est pas valide.

Exemples

Pour obtenir un exemple de propriété ValueAsDouble , consultez la ValueAsBoolean propriété.

Remarques

Si le schéma ou les XPathNavigator informations de type (par exemple, à partir d’un XmlDocument objet initialisé avec une validation XmlReaderde schéma XML), et si le nœud actuel est défini en tant que type de schéma xs:double XML, la ValueAsDouble propriété retourne la valeur du nœud actuel en tant qu’objet nonboxé Double .

Toutefois, si le XPathNavigator schéma n’a pas d’informations de type ou de schéma, la ValueAsDouble propriété tente de convertir la valeur de chaîne du nœud actuel en Double valeur, conformément aux règles de cast XPath 2.0 pour xsd:double.

S’applique à